A badger in my garden: what to do?. The badger is a shy and discreet animal.

It has a reputation for causing damage to gardens and vegetable gardens, but it is not on the list of species likely to be classified as pests. Like many wild animals, it only seeks food. It's up to you to decide whether you want to live with this useful animal, by making a few adjustments, or whether you really want to show him the way out. You can finally scare it away from your garden by installing motion detectors using lighting.
